Why e-commerce operators use the days sales outstanding (dso).
Calculate Days Sales Outstanding — the average days to collect payment after a sale. High DSO ties up working capital.

Benchmarks
What good looks like — typical ranges to compare against.
< 30 days
Excellent — strong collections
30–45 days
Healthy
45–60 days
Watch closely
> 60 days
Cash flow risk
The formula
How days sales outstanding (dso) is calculated.
DSO = (Accounts Receivable ÷ Revenue) × Period (days)Industry context
